📋 Description

• Oversee end-to-end management of Salesforce.com for sales and service, and the lending platform, including configuration, customization, data integrity, user adoption, and integration with tools like ZoomInfo, Microsoft Power BI, and other platforms to support revenue and customer operations, as well as risk, ops, and lending. • Design and implement scalable sales processes, including lead management, pipeline forecasting, territory planning, and quota setting, to drive efficiency and predictability in revenue outcomes for point-of-sale financing solutions. • Lead the development and execution of a comprehensive sales enablement program, delivering training, content (e.g., pitch decks, playbooks), tools, and coaching to empower sales teams to effectively sell financing solutions in B2B and B2B2C contexts. • Manage and guide the Contractor Solutions Consultant, ensuring seamless contractor and borrower experiences, technical sales support, and effective communication between sales, project management, and external partners to drive client satisfaction and platform adoption. • Foster alignment across sales, marketing, and account management to streamline the revenue cycle, from lead generation to customer retention, ensuring a cohesive go-to-market strategy tailored to the home improvement industry. • Spearhead the adoption of AI-driven tools (e.g., predictive analytics, conversational AI, sales automation) to enhance lead scoring, personalize outreach, and optimize sales and service workflows. • Leverage Microsoft Power BI, Salesforce.com, and other analytics platforms to deliver actionable insights, track key performance indicators (KPIs) such as conversion rates, sales cycle length, and customer satisfaction, and drive continuous improvement in revenue performance. • Develop and pilot innovative sales strategies, such as account-based selling, subscription-based financing models, or hybrid B2B/B2B2C approaches, to anticipate market trends and drive sustainable growth in point-of-sale lending. • Act as a key representative in client-facing environments when necessary, engaging with contractors, partners, and key stakeholders to build trust, demonstrate value, and strengthen partnerships in the home improvement financing space. • Build, lead, and mentor a high-performing sales operations, enablement, and Contractor Experience and Solutions Consultant team, fostering a culture of innovation, accountability, and collaboration while driving team engagement and career growth. • Partner closely with technology, risk, product, marketing, sales, account management, and the PMO to align strategies, ensure platform enhancements meet client needs, mitigate risks, and deliver cohesive business outcomes. • Effectively manage multiple work streams and projects, prioritizing initiatives, aligning resources, and ensuring timely execution across sales operations, enablement, and contractor experience functions. • Ensure all sales operations, enablement, and service processes are thoroughly documented and accessible, enabling scalability and knowledge transfer across the organization. • Continuously assess and refine sales, service, and contractor experience processes, tools, and training programs based on feedback, market trends, and performance data to maximize efficiency and revenue impact in B2B and B2B2C markets.

🎯 Requirements

• Bachelor’s degree in Business, Finance, Marketing, Communications, or a related field required. • 8+ years of experience in sales operations, revenue operations, or sales enablement, with at least 4 years in a senior leadership role, ideally in point-of-sale lending, financial services, fintech, or B2B/B2B2C industries. • Expert-level proficiency in Salesforce.com administration and optimization for both sales and service functions, including custom objects, workflows, dashboards, and integrations with tools like ZoomInfo and Microsoft Power BI. • Proven track record of implementing AI-driven tools and advanced analytics to enhance sales performance, lead generation, service delivery, and forecasting accuracy in point-of-sale lending or similar markets. • Extensive experience leading and mentoring high-performing teams, including roles like Contractor Experience and Solutions Consultant, fostering a culture of collaboration, accountability, and excellence. • Strong comfort and success in client-facing environments, with the ability to build relationships, articulate value propositions, and represent the company to contractors, partners, and stakeholders. • Demonstrated ability to manage multiple work streams and projects, prioritizing effectively and collaborating with technology, risk, product, marketing, sales, account management, and the PMO to drive business outcomes. • Deep understanding of sales enablement best practices, including training program development, content creation, and coaching methodologies tailored to B2B and B2B2C sales cycles. • Strong knowledge of revenue operations principles, with experience aligning sales, marketing, and account management to drive end-to-end revenue growth. • Exceptional leadership and communication skills, with the ability to influence cross-functional stakeholders and present strategic insights to C-suite executives. • Analytical expertise in using data visualization tools (e.g., Microsoft Power BI) and CRM platforms to drive decision-making and measure enablement impact. •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) for documentation, presentations, and process management. • Experience with additional sales enablement tools (e.g., LinkedIn Sales Navigator, Highspot, Gong) and AI platforms (e.g., Gong, Clari, Outreach) is a plus.
